JFC - Cooked Rice High Quality Japanese has a average-calorie, average-carb, low-fat and average-protein content.
The food contains 32.45g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 2.82 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the low f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is low in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.
It belongs to Japanese c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
Based on the composite nutritive standing JFC - Cooked Rice High Quality Japanese has been given a composite ranking of 76, and in moderation.
